IDAC Head Andrea Johnson Resigns

27 July 2026 by Guest

Statement by Adv Glynnis Breytenbach MP – DA Spokesperson on Justice and Constitutional Development:

The Democratic Alliance (DA) notes the resignation of the Investigating Director and Head of the Investigating Directorate Against Corruption (IDAC), Andrea Johnson, with immediate effect, following evidence presented before the Madlanga Commission.

Ms Johnson’s resignation comes at a time when serious questions have been raised through the Commission’s proceedings. It is appropriate that the Commission be allowed to complete its work independently and without interference, so that all relevant facts can be properly established.

The DA will not now speculate on the implications of the evidence or seek to pre-empt the Commission’s findings. However, public confidence in institutions tasked with combating corruption depends on transparency, accountability, and the willingness of those entrusted with public responsibilities to be held to the highest ethical standards.

The resignation of Ms Johnson underscores the importance of allowing the Commission to continue its work without fear, favour or prejudice. South Africans deserve a full and credible account of the matters before the Commission, together with appropriate action where wrongdoing is ultimately established.

The evidence presented underscores the dire need for a truly independent Anti Corruption body situated outside of the National Prosecuting Authority.

The DA will continue to monitor developments closely and remains committed to strengthening the integrity, independence and credibility of South Africa’s anti-corruption bodies.
